Guava Safed (White Guava) is packed with a lot of nutrients minerals and compounds that are vital to our health which assist in treating some ailments. This fruit is round or sometimes oval depending upon the species. Guava helps to protect the immune system, regulate blood pressure and lowers risk of diabetes. It further helps to strengthen the digestive system. Impressive amount of minerals, vitamins and phytonutrients that are found in guava, low calorie count of this fruit is what so many people love. It can provide energy and the nutrients needed to get through the day, without increasing the amount of calories. It is highly cultivated in India.

1. Guava fruits taste better when picked earlier than they fully mature.
2. Fruits are highly nutritious, rich in vitamin C and can be eaten raw, its seeds are edible too.
3. Ripened fruits can be used to make guava ice-cream, juice, jam, chutney, sauce or desserts.
1. Grows well in full sun throughout the day. Requires very little care.
2. Can be grown in a wide range of soils.
3. This plant requires 15 to 30 litres of water per day to maintain constant moisture in the soil.
4. The optimum temperature for germination falls in the range of 20°C – 28°C .
5. Apply organic fertiliser moderately.
